Overview

Tokyo Road: Best of Bon Jovi is the third official greatest hits compilation by the American rock band Bon Jovi, released exclusively in Japan in 2001. It serves as a curated “rock tracks” collection spanning the band’s career from their early 1980s recordings through their 2000 hits, tailored for the Japanese market. The compilation captures Bon Jovi’s evolution from glam‑metal chart toppers to arena‑ready rock icons, combining fan favorites with a refreshed single to anchor the collection.

The album performed strongly in Japan, peaking at #5 on the Oricon Weekly Albums Chart and selling over 400,000 copies, earning double platinum certification from the Recording Industry Association of Japan (RIAJ).

Fun Facts & Trivia

  • Japan Exclusive: The album was released only in Japan, making it a collector’s item outside of Asia.

  • Opening Remix: The first track, “One Wild Night 2001,” is a remixed version of the Crush single, released as a promotional single with its own video.

  • Chart Success: It reached #5 on Oricon’s Weekly Albums Chart, a strong showing for a regional compilation.

  • Double Platinum: The album sold more than 400,000 copies and was certified 2× Platinum in Japan.

  • Title Track: “Tokyo Road” hails from the 7800° Fahrenheit era and was chosen as a centerpiece due to its cultural resonance in Japan.

  • Live Bonus: The first pressing included a bonus mini disc with live tracks, including solo performances from Jon Bon Jovi and Richie Sambora.

  • Balanced Selection: The compilation mixes classic anthems from Slippery When Wet and New Jersey with later rockers like “It’s My Life” and “Just Older.”
